What is Adobe Firefly?

Adobe Firefly is Adobe’s family of generative AI models, launched in 2023. It is designed specifically for creative and professional use, with the most important distinguishing feature being its training data — unlike many AI image generators trained on scraped web data, Firefly is trained on licensed Adobe Stock imagery and public domain content, making its outputs commercially safe for use in client work, advertising and commercial projects without copyright concerns.

Firefly is integrated throughout Adobe Creative Cloud — directly into Photoshop (Generative Fill, Generative Expand), Illustrator (Text to Vector Graphic, Generative Shape Fill), Adobe Express, Adobe Experience Manager and other Adobe products. There is also a standalone Firefly web app where anyone can access AI generation features without a Creative Cloud subscription.

Adobe Firefly Key Features

  • Text to Image. Generate images from text prompts with commercial-safe, high-quality results suitable for professional use.
  • Generative Fill (Photoshop). Select any area of an image in Photoshop and fill it with AI-generated content that matches the context — remove objects, add backgrounds, replace elements.
  • Generative Expand (Photoshop). Extend an image beyond its borders by generating new content that seamlessly matches the original.
  • Text to Vector Graphic (Illustrator). Generate scalable vector graphics, icons and illustrations from text descriptions.
  • Text Effects. Apply stunning, photorealistic text effects — fire, flowers, liquid, neon — to any text directly from a prompt.
  • Generative Shape Fill (Illustrator). Fill vector shapes with AI-generated content matching a text description.
  • Structure Reference. Upload an image to guide the composition and structure of AI-generated results.
  • Style Reference. Match the visual style of a reference image without copying it.

Adobe Firefly and Commercial Safety

The most important aspect of Adobe Firefly for professional and commercial users is its training data provenance. Adobe trained Firefly on Adobe Stock (a library of professionally licensed images), openly licensed content and content in the public domain — deliberately avoiding scraping unlicensed web content.

This means that content generated with Firefly is commercially safe — Adobe offers an IP indemnification commitment for enterprise customers, meaning Adobe will cover legal costs if a generated image is challenged as infringing third-party intellectual property. This makes Firefly the most trusted AI image tool for advertising agencies, brand design teams and commercial creative studios that cannot risk copyright disputes.

Adobe Firefly Pricing

Adobe Firefly has a standalone free plan with limited monthly generative credits. The web app is accessible at firefly.adobe.com without a Creative Cloud subscription. Paid plans include:

  • Free: 25 generative credits/month, access to Text to Image, Text Effects and other web features.
  • Firefly Premium ($4.99/month): 100 generative credits/month, faster generation and priority access.
  • Creative Cloud subscription: All Creative Cloud plans include Firefly integration with monthly credit allowances and full integration in Photoshop, Illustrator and other apps.

Adobe Firefly Pros and Cons

Pros

  • Commercially safe training data with IP indemnification for enterprise
  • Deeply integrated into industry-standard creative tools (Photoshop, Illustrator)
  • Generative Fill is one of the most useful AI editing features available
  • Free web app available without Creative Cloud subscription
  • Vector generation in Illustrator is unique compared to most AI tools
  • Excellent text effect generation

Cons

  • Photorealistic output quality is not yet at the level of Midjourney or Flux
  • Limited free monthly credits for standalone use
  • Full Creative Cloud integration requires a paid CC subscription
  • The standalone app has less community and fewer creative controls than dedicated AI art tools

How to Get Started With Adobe Firefly

  1. Go to firefly.adobe.com and sign in with a free Adobe account.
  2. Choose “Text to Image” and enter a detailed prompt describing your desired image.
  3. Select an aspect ratio and content type (photo, graphic, art) and generate.
  4. Use the style and colour controls to refine results.
  5. For Photoshop integration: open any image in Photoshop, select an area and use “Generative Fill” in the contextual toolbar.
  6. For Illustrator: use “Text to Vector Graphic” from the Object menu to generate scalable SVG graphics.

What is Generative Fill in Photoshop?

Generative Fill is a Photoshop feature powered by Firefly that fills any selected area of an image with AI-generated content matching the surrounding context. It is one of the most useful AI editing tools available — use it to remove objects, extend backgrounds, add elements and transform photos non-destructively.
